“The difference between "winners" and "losers" is not whether they face obstacles and setbacks - we all do, and it is inevitable that plans do not unfold exactly as imagined or that unexpected events surprise us or that a few mistakes happen. The real difference is that "winners" bounce back from a fumble or a loss by refusing to panic, analyzing the situation and looking for positive actions they can take to correct the problem, and then go on to resume winning.”

Rosabeth Moss Kanter

About This Quote

Source Book: "The Change Masters" by Rosabeth Moss Kanter, 1983

Winners differ by their response to setbacks: they stay calm, analyze, and take corrective action, whereas losers may panic or give up.

In simple terms: Winners recover and act, losers panic.
